Bronx mom accused of killing 6-year-old daughter in NYCHA complex

THE BRONX, N.Y. (PIX11) — A Bronx mother is accused of killing her 6-year-old daughter in their NYCHA apartment last year, police said Thursday.

Lynija Eason Kumar, 27, was arrested and charged with murder and manslaughter in connection to the May 26, 2023 incident, according to the NYPD.

The child, Jalayah Eason, was found unconscious with bruising on her wrists and trauma to her torso in the 12th-floor apartment at East 165th Street in the Forest Houses complex just before 4 a.m., police said. The girl was rushed to the hospital but could not be saved.

The medical examiner determined the incident was a homicide in February, police said.

The mother told detectives she found the child out of her bed on the floor near a closet, sources told PIX11 News at the time.

Jalayah’s two siblings, then 8 and 3, were in the apartment, and sources told PIX11 News they showed signs of abuse. The mom was charged with endangering the welfare of a child in connection to their injuries, according to court records. The siblings were placed in the custody of the Administration for Children’s Services at the time of the incident, the sources said.

Sources told PIX11 News Thursday that ACS has taken action to protect the minors.

Kumar was questioned after the incident but was not charged in the girl’s death until Thursday, police said. Her arraignment was pending Thursday.
